The 9th Annual Real Estate West Forum is a local peer-to-peer educational event exclusively for the institutional and high net worth wealth management community with a specific focus on allocations to real estate.

The forum brings together investors, funds, and advisers for a one-day meeting to discuss sectors, due diligence, and real estate investment opportunities in the US and around the world.

The investor-focused event provides a due diligence platform for US based and international pension funds, foundations, endowments, fund of funds, family offices, wealth managers, consultants, and sovereign wealth funds interested in direct research on real estate opportunities.

KEYNOTE SPEAKERS

Ted Egan, Chief Economist, City and County of San Francisco

Ted Egan has been the Chief Economist of the City and County of San Francisco since 2007. He and his team are charged with reporting to decision-makers and voters on the economic impact of major city legislation, and he has authored or co-authored over 125 legislative impact reports in his time at the City. Before joining the City, he managed economic development strategy projects for ICF International, with clients across North America, Europe, the Middle East, and Latin America. He received his Ph.D. from UC Berkeley, and taught in the Economics and City Planning Departments at Berkeley for over ten years.

Key Discussion Topics

State of the Industry

Join industry leaders as we kick off the day with a compelling dialogue on how real estate markets are performing. Which sectors of the real estate market are asset allocators actively researching? Which sectors are underperforming? How are investors and managers successfully diversifying their real estate portfolios?

 

Top Trends Impacting Geographic Markets

Which geographic locations are offering noteworthy real estate opportunities in 2025? Which asset classes are performing favorably in different regions? How are research teams analyzing the supply and demand in specific markets to unearth investment opportunities with maximum upside potential? How are west coast markets performing compared to other regions across the U.S.?

 

A Gradual Thaw in U.S. Housing

How are housing supply, rental vacancies, and mortgage rate impacting the housing sector? What are industry leaders forecasting for multifamily rentals? What are your thoughts on price corrections? Are you currently exposed to affordable housing within your portfolio? How are single family rental markets? How are the manufactured housing, student housing, and accessible housing sectors impacted by market trends? How are homes in the Bay Area being priced in 2025?

 

Niche Real Estate Properties to Allocate to in 2025

Which alternative real estate property types are being considered by your investment team? Niche real estate strategies are continuing to gain favor amongst the private wealth management community. Life sciences, data centers, cold storage, luxury garages, film studios, medical office buildings, among others, are being woven into investment research conversations. How are these sectors performing? How is investors’ appetite for risk evolving as it relates to niche property types?
